Heads up, new folks: every event that hits the Quillstream bus has to match a schema registered in Fenwick, our schema registry. Bump versions, never edit in place. Once your schema passes compat checks, the publish job signs the registry snapshot before promotion. That job needs the registry signing key, which is pasted directly below.

deploy key for kajof-yawif: bky9_fvxrpdHPq

TURN-208: Gatevale turnstile counters at the Merrow Field pilot double-count when a rotation reverses mid-cycle. Attendance totals drift roughly 2% high per event. The debounce window fix is implemented, reviewed by Ilsa, and soak-tested across two simulated match days without drift. Ready for your cut; the candidate build is identified below.

trace token, tagag-tafog: htk6_5ed18c

Responsibility for the Stockweave nightly inventory reconciliation job is transferring to a new maintainer effective the next release cycle. If your plugin hooks into the reconciliation lifecycle events, please note that compatibility questions, schema change proposals, and deprecation notices will now be handled by the new owner. Existing extension points remain stable through the current major version; any breaking changes will be announced eight weeks in advance. Direct all correspondence to the maintainer named below.

account owner for bawip-tahag: Raleth Quenok

## Fan-Out Backpressure — Release Notes Context

The Beaconline notifier sheds load when downstream queues exceed 80% capacity. Releases that touch the dispatch layer must verify backpressure thresholds before rollout; a bad config in v2.3 once silently dropped low-priority pushes for six hours. Check the shed-rate dashboard during canary. Do not ship if shed rate exceeds 2%. Threshold config and canary checklist are on the internal page below.

operations page: https://jenkins.zemvarcloud.local/job/merge_requests/repo/build/73930b4b30f0a8ed

**14:22** — Dedup job on the Fernbright customer store began merging records that shared only a postal code, collapsing roughly 1,800 distinct customers. On-call paused the Tidemark pipeline and restored from the 13:00 snapshot. Root cause: a relaxed matching rule shipped without review. The faulty behaviour was introduced in the following build.

trace token, tawep-fahif: htk3_b58